Postdoctoral fellow positions are available in the laboratory of Dr. Lu Wang in the Sam and Ann Barshop Institute for Longevity and Aging Studies, Department of Biochemistry and Structural Biology at UT Health San Antonio. We are investigating epigenetic regulation in aging and age-related diseases, with a focus on understanding the regulation of three-dimensional genome organization, DNA and histone modifications in aging, metabolic disorders, and cancer. Our group is supported by funding from NIH and CPRIT. We are particularly interested in applicants with expertise in genomics/epigenetics, computational biology, molecular biology, biochemistry research, and mouse models.
